ACCIDENTS NEWS
- ➤ On Wednesday night, Murfreesboro Fire Rescue Department responded to a fire on Ridgecrest Drive that displaced a family—firefighters found heavy smoke in the kitchen, rescued a cat, and reported no injuries while the American Red Cross assisted as the Fire Marshal investigates the cause. CRIME NEWS
- ➤ A 55-year-old woman hit in a Kroger parking lot on South Church Street on Aug. 24 died on Sept. 3; authorities arrested 44-year-old Murfreesboro resident Heather Keller on Aug. 25—she faces multiple felony charges—. FOX 17
- ➤ Police searched near TownePlace Suites by Marriott along I-24 after license plate cameras detected a stolen Toyota Camry while evacuating construction workers, and drone pilots assisted officers in looking for a North Carolina suspect accused of murder and kidnapping—though the suspect remained at large. G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 TDOT is upgrading two exit ramps along Interstate 24 in Rutherford County to ease congestion. Motorists at the Exit 81 ramp near State Route 10 may see delays as crews widen and lengthen that ramp—work at Exit 84 is also underway and is expected to finish in October. The Daily News Journal
HEALTH NEWS
- ➤ Rutherford County health inspectors released scores from August 28 to September 4 for schools, food service establishments, and swimming pools in Murfreesboro and Smyrna—scores are posted for public review and inspectors visit each location twice a year. Rutherford County Source
- ➤ Lawmakers in Tennessee are reviewing bills that would stop healthcare providers from reporting patients’ medical debt to consumer reporting agencies—aimed at easing financial stress linked to poor mental health. The proposals, introduced by Sen. London Lamar and Rep. Vincent Dixie, could impose fines or up to six months in jail for violations if passed. WGNS
